#RussiaStudiesNationalStablecoin Strategic Digital Sovereignty in 2026


Russia is accelerating efforts to strengthen financial independence through the exploration of a national stablecoin initiative. Amid ongoing geopolitical and sanctions-related pressures, policymakers are examining how blockchain-based payment systems can reduce reliance on traditional correspondent banking networks and foreign currency settlement channels. This initiative reflects a broader push toward digital sovereignty and monetary resilience.
Alongside this effort, the Central Bank of Russia continues development of the Digital Ruble, scheduled for wider rollout in September 2026. While the Digital Ruble is primarily focused on domestic payments and retail infrastructure modernization, the proposed national stablecoin concept extends further — targeting cross-border trade and international settlement mechanisms.
The national stablecoin under consideration would likely be ruble-backed and structured to facilitate international transactions with partner economies. Policymakers are studying global stablecoin frameworks throughout 2026 to evaluate issuance models, custody structures, transparency requirements, and compliance safeguards. Two issuance pathways are reportedly being reviewed: direct issuance by the central bank or regulated issuance through licensed financial institutions under strict supervisory oversight.
This development is closely tied to Russia’s broader cryptocurrency regulatory framework, which aims to provide legal clarity for digital assets within the country. By formally recognizing digital assets as regulated monetary instruments, authorities seek to create a predictable environment for both institutional and retail adoption. Regulatory alignment is viewed as essential for maintaining monetary control while enabling innovation.
Strategically, a national stablecoin would serve multiple objectives: enabling trade settlement beyond traditional banking rails, lowering transaction friction, maintaining oversight of digital liquidity flows, and reinforcing domestic monetary authority in an increasingly digital global economy. If implemented successfully, the initiative could reshape how Russia participates in cross-border finance and influence broader discussions on sovereign digital currency models worldwide.
